Output 782ff66796c0d233b23f16c77fc348f88c009a97e3af08d0054742ccc18a97ce:39

value
10869051
script pubkey
OP_0 OP_PUSHBYTES_20 bc8bd92ee27180be5a34dd692554d53c3a05ea6e
address
ltc1qhj9ajthzwxqtuk35m45j24x48saqt6nwpug369
transaction
782ff66796c0d233b23f16c77fc348f88c009a97e3af08d0054742ccc18a97ce
spent
true